Numbers 10:17 - Christian Standard Bible Anglicised The tabernacle was then taken down, and the Gershonites and the Merarites set out, transporting the tabernacle. Tuilleadh leaganachaKing James Version (Oxford) 1769 And the tabernacle was taken down; and the sons of Gershon and the sons of Merari set forward, bearing the tabernacle. Amplified Bible - Classic Edition When the tabernacle was taken down, the sons of Gershon and Merari, bearing [it] on their shoulders, set out. American Standard Version (1901) And the tabernacle was taken down; and the sons of Gershon and the sons of Merari, who bare the tabernacle, set forward. Common English Bible The dwelling was taken down, and the Gershonites and the Merarites, who carried the dwelling, marched. Catholic Public Domain Version And the tabernacle was taken down, because the sons of Gershon and Merari, who carry it, were departing. Douay-Rheims version of The Bible - 1752 version And the tabernacle was taken down: and the sons of Gerson and Merari set forward, bearing it. |
